Output ecbe821ccf85f088e6fb09bbe7ac4fe56ece2f01aa3b14728072b97aac735876:7

value
63594
script pubkey
OP_0 OP_PUSHBYTES_20 5c27d1a096880be1dadbcf894bd0c43ea1e76104
address
bc1qtsnargyk3q97rkkme7y5h5xy86s7wcgye0j09a
transaction
ecbe821ccf85f088e6fb09bbe7ac4fe56ece2f01aa3b14728072b97aac735876
spent
true